Attribute | Value |
---|---|
New / Used | Used |
Frequency Range | 1 GHz – 20 GHz |
Frequency Resolution | 1 kHz (1 Hz with Option 008) |
SSB Phase Noise | –76 dBc/Hz @ 10 GHz, 10 kHz offset (typical) |
Calibrated Output Power | +11 dBm (≤ 18 GHz) / +8 dBm (18 – 20 GHz); down to –110 dBm with Option 1E1 step attenuator |
Analog Modulation | Standard AM & FM (optional ΦM/pulse via external source) |
The pre-owned Agilent 83711A delivers synthesized accuracy and analog-sweep speed across 1 GHz to 20 GHz, making it a cost-effective local oscillator or broadband CW driver for mixers, converters and EMC setups. A built-in fractional-N synthesizer steps as fine as 1 kHz (1 Hz with Option 008) while typical phase noise of -76 dBc/Hz at 10 GHz keeps noise-figure and spur measurements reliable.
With the optional 90 dB step attenuator, the source spans +11 dBm to -110 dBm, eliminating external pads during PA compression or receiver-sensitivity tests. Standard AM/FM modulation supports radar IF simulation or telemetry tone injection, and SCPI/LAN/GPIB control lets the unit drop straight into automated benches.
Refurbished units ship ISO-17025-calibrated and firmware-verified, reducing capital cost and lead-time yet preserving Agilent reliability and long-term serviceability.
